Investigating the effect of the CEOs power on the risk of falling stock prices of companies listed on the Tehran Stock Exchange

Abstract
The phenomenon of falling stock prices, which causes a sharp decrease in returns, has been more studied by researchers compared to jumps. Also, the position of the CEO is considered as a source of power and the main operator of the company's innovation strategy and as a leader in creating value for shareholders. Therefore, the purpose of this research is to examine whether the power of the CEO has a significant effect on the risk of falling stock prices of companies listed on the Tehran Stock Exchange. The statistical population of companies admitted to Tehran Stock Exchange between 1392 and 1400 and using the information of 129 companies and the multivariable linear regression method, the hypothesis was tested. According to the results of the hypothesis test, it was determined that the power of the CEO has a significant effect on the risk of falling stock prices of companies listed on the Tehran Stock Exchange.
